I am happy to share special information to you that first in the history of
Library and Information Science in India, Department of Library and
Information Science, Annamalai University has awarded 100 Ph.D degrees to
Library Science professionals from all over India.  In this context, the
department is planning to honour all these Ph.D recipients during the
organization of two days UGC sponsored national level seminar on
"Application of Quantitative and Qualitative Indicators for Effective
Information Management in Academic Libraries" to be held at Annamalai
University on 28th & 29th March 2014.  In this connection, I request all
